On some fixed point results using simulation functions via w-distance with applications
Said Atallaoui1, Fady Hasan2, Wasfi Shatanawi2,3,4
1Department of Mathematics, Ziane Achour University, Djelfa 17000, Algeria.
Abstract:
Based on the notion of class of simulation functions, we launch the concept of --contraction on the setting of w-distance mappings. We employ our new concept to formulate and prove several fixed point results over the complete metric spaces. Also, we provide some concrete examples to show the usability of the obtained results. Furthermore, we study the existence of a unique solution of nonlinear fractional differential equations, nonlinear integral equations and spring-mass system problems. The results presented in this manuscript generalize many of the results known in the literature.
